What is a Car Key Locksmith?

A car key locksmith, likewise called an automotive locksmith, focuses on the production, replacement, and repair of car keys and locks. They have the competence to deal with a wide variety of automotive security concerns, from conventional lock-and-key systems to innovative electronic keyless entry systems. These professionals are geared up with the current tools and technologies to assist with numerous key-related emergency situations and upkeep needs.

Providers Offered by Car Key Locksmiths

Car key locksmith professionals use a diverse selection of services to meet the particular needs of their clients. Here are a few of the most common services:

  1. Key Replacement

    • Lost Keys: If you've lost your initial keys, a locksmith can provide a replicate.
    • Stolen Keys: In cases of theft, locksmiths can not only replace your keys however likewise reprogram the car's immobilizer system to prevent unauthorized access.
  2. Key Cutting

    • Replicating Keys: Creating specific copies of your existing car keys.
    • Cutting New Keys: Generating brand-new keys for older cars that might not have spare keys.
  3. Key Reprogramming

    • Transponder Keys: Many contemporary cars utilize transponder keys that need to be programmed to the vehicle's onboard computer system.
    • Push-button Control Keys: Reprogramming key fobs to guarantee they work correctly with the car's remote entry system.
  4. Lock Repair and Replacement

    • Harmed Locks: Fixing locks that are jammed or malfunctioning.
    • Used Lock Cylinders: Replacing old or worn lock cylinders to enhance security.
  5. Key Extraction

    • Broken Keys: Removing keys that have broken off in the lock without causing further damage.
  6. Emergency Situation Lockout Services

    • Lockouts: Quickly accessing to your vehicle when you're locked out.

The Role of Technology in Car Key Locksmithing

The evolution of automotive innovation has considerably affected the field of locksmithing. Modern cars frequently feature sophisticated security systems, consisting of:

  •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that communicates with the car's computer system to allow ignition. Reprogramming these keys requires specialized devices and proficiency.
  • Remote Control Keys: Key fobs with integrated transmitters that lock and open the car remotely. These need to be integrated with the car's receiver.
  • Keyless Entry Systems: Some cars utilize clever keys or keyless entry systems, where the key fob does not need to be physically placed into the lock.

Car key locksmith professionals need to remain updated with these improvements to provide trusted services. They purchase continuous training and the most recent tools to ensure they can manage any circumstance that emerges.

Finding a Reliable Car Key Locksmith

When you need the services of a car key locksmith, it's crucial to select a trusted and qualified professional. Here are some suggestions to help you find the ideal one:

  1. Research and Reviews

    • Look for locksmith professionals with positive reviews and an excellent credibility.
    • Inspect online platforms like Google, Yelp, and local service directories.
  2. Licensing and Certification

    • Ensure the locksmith is licensed and accredited by relevant organizations.
    • In the United States, search for locksmiths licensed by the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A).
  3. Experience and Expertise

    • Pick a locksmith with experience in managing various types of car keys.
    • Inquire about their experience with specific car designs if you have a distinct or high-security vehicle.
  4. Accessibility

    • Go with a locksmith who provides 24/7 emergency situation services.
    • Examine their action time and schedule for non-emergency demands.
  5. Prices and Transparency

    • Compare costs from different locksmith professionals.
    • Ensure the locksmith offers a clear and transparent expense estimate before starting the work.

Frequently Asked Questions About Car Key Locksmiths

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?

  • A: Contact a professional car key locksmith instantly. They can provide a replicate key and, if essential, reprogram the car's immobilizer system to ensure your vehicle remains protected.

Q: How long does it take to get a new car key?

  • A: The time can differ depending on the intricacy of the key and the locksmith's equipment. For easy keys, it can take as little as 20-30 minutes, while more innovative keys might take up to a couple of hours.

Q: Are all car key locksmith professionals the very same?

  • A: No, the quality and expertise of locksmiths can differ significantly. Search for a locksmith who is licensed, certified, and has a good reputation.

Q: Can a car key locksmith assistance with a jammed lock?

  • A: Yes, car key locksmiths are trained to repair and replace jammed or malfunctioning locks. They can likewise offer guidance on preventing future concerns.

Q: Is it legal to make a copy of my car key?

  • A: Yes, it is legal to make a copy of your car key. Nevertheless, it's crucial to use a trusted locksmith who will validate your ownership of the vehicle before producing a duplicate.

Q: How can I avoid losing my car keys?

  • A: Keep your keys in a designated area in the house, use a key chain with a tracker, and think about having a spare key made and stored in a safe location.

Tips for Maintaining Your Car Keys

Proper maintenance of your car keys can avoid lots of common issues. Here are some pointers to keep your type in excellent condition:

  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Do not utilize extreme chemicals or solvents to clean your keys, as they can harm the electronic elements.
  • Stay up to date with Battery Replacements: If your key fob has a battery, replace it regularly to ensure it functions effectively.
  • Shop in a Safe Place: Keep your keys far from extreme temperature levels and moisture to avoid damage.
  • Routine Check-Ups: Have your keys and locks inspected periodically by a professional to determine and deal with any prospective issues early.
